// ECMA 15.3.2 The Function Constructor
JSObject* constructFunction(ExecState* exec, const ArgList& args, const Identifier& functionName, const UString& sourceURL, int lineNumber)
{
    // Functions need to have a space following the opening { due to for web compatibility
    // see https://bugs.webkit.org/show_bug.cgi?id=24350
    // We also need \n before the closing } to handle // comments at the end of the last line
    UString program;
    if (args.isEmpty())
        program = "(function() { \n})";
    else if (args.size() == 1)
        program = "(function() { " + args.at(0).toString(exec) + "\n})";
    else {
        program = "(function(" + args.at(0).toString(exec);
        for (size_t i = 1; i < args.size() - 1; i++)
            program += "," + args.at(i).toString(exec);
        program += ") { " + args.at(args.size() - 1).toString(exec) + "\n})";
    }

    int errLine;
    UString errMsg;
    SourceCode source = makeSource(program, sourceURL, lineNumber);
    RefPtr<ProgramNode> programNode = exec->globalData().parser->parse<ProgramNode>(exec, exec->dynamicGlobalObject()->debugger(), source, &errLine, &errMsg);

    FunctionBodyNode* body = extractFunctionBody(programNode.get());
    if (!body)
        return throwError(exec, SyntaxError, errMsg, errLine, source.provider()->asID(), source.provider()->url());

    JSGlobalObject* globalObject = exec->lexicalGlobalObject();
    ScopeChain scopeChain(globalObject, globalObject->globalData(), exec->globalThisValue());
    return new (exec) JSFunction(exec, functionName, body, scopeChain.node());
}
